Pricing Comparison

Pricing may change over time. Always verify current plans on the official websites before purchasing.

The cost divide between Rytr pricing vs Jasper pricing represents one of the most drastic pricing gaps in the SaaS industry, directly impacting your monthly operating overhead.

PlanRytrJasper
Free PlanPermanent 10,000 characters/mo allocationLimited trial credits only
Lowest Paid PlanSaver Plan: $9/mo (100k characters)Creator Plan: $49/mo (Single user seat)
Team PlanUnlimited Plan: $29/mo (Unlimited words)Pro Plan: $69/mo (Includes 3 user seats)
EnterpriseCustom quotes for managed team poolsCustom quotes with advanced SSO/API access

Who Wins on Pricing?

Rytr wins the pricing category by a landslide. For an independent creator, individual freelancer, or bootstrapped business owner, Rytr’s financial value is unmatched. For $29 a month, the Unlimited plan removes all character constraints, allowing you to generate copy without worrying about monthly word caps or usage tier adjustments.

Jasper is a substantial financial investment. Its baseline plan ($49/month) is more expensive than Rytr’s absolute top-tier unlimited package. Jasper’s pricing reflects its position as a corporate platform; it builds its value around team orchestration, custom integrations, and brand safety. If your primary goal is software cost minimization while protecting baseline writing speed, Rytr is the clear choice.

Deep-Dive Feature Analysis

  • The Content Workspace Environment: Rytr’s workspace relies entirely on its dual-pane, distraction-free environment. Changing templates, testing different tones, and rewriting sentences happens within a single view. Jasper’s environment mimics a modern, collaborative document platform like Google Docs, loaded with a side chat interface, inline command prompts, and structural optimization sidebars.
  • Tone Control and Custom Persona Training: Rytr manages tone through a pre-configured dropdown selection of over 20 variations (e.g., Assertive, Humorous, Formal). It adapts sentence lengths and word choices dynamically but stays within fixed boundaries. Jasper features an advanced brand voice modeling engine. It can read a pasted block of your existing company material or parse your website to build a custom brand memory profile that captures your exact corporate identity.
  • Live Web Data Access Capabilities: Rytr operates on pre-trained, static base models, which means it can struggle to write accurately about events that occurred past its training cutoff without direct user guidance. Jasper integrates real-time web search layers directly into its prompt workspace, allowing it to scrape the current live web, reference active news events, and include accurate contemporary citations.

Blogging Comparison

When evaluating both tools for long-form editorial content and complete article generation, Jasper emerges as the superior choice.

Jasper’s integrated long-form document dashboard handles context window tracking exceptionally well. When writing an article that exceeds 2,000 words, Jasper constantly reads the entire document layout. This enables the engine to use smooth structural transitions between subheadings, maintain a single logical narrative arc, and avoid the repetitive phrasing patterns that frequently plague baseline language models. Writers can issue direct instructions to the AI anywhere on the canvas by typing commands or interacting with the sidebar wizard.

Rytr approaches blogging from a completely modular angle. Rather than compiling an entire piece from a single title prompt, users must execute the process section by section. You start by running the “Blog Idea & Outline” use case to build your H2/H3 architecture. From there, you must manually highlight every heading and activate the contextual “Blog Section” tool to flesh out paragraphs isolated from one another. This provides fantastic granular control over specific arguments, but it creates a heavier editing burden on the blogger, who must manually tie the pieces together into a coherent final draft.


Affiliate Marketing Comparison

For active affiliate marketers who run diverse portfolios of niche evaluation sites, Rytr holds a distinct functional advantage.

Affiliate marketing systems require high asset production volume across distinct product lists, comparison grids, social signals, and landing pages to test keywords and capture organic traffic. Rytr’s Unlimited plan allows an affiliate operator to run endless variations of product summaries, meta-description tags, and alternative outreach sequences without checking a usage meter. The tool contains excellent templates for conversion frameworks like PAS (Problem, Agitate, Solution) and AIDA, which output punchy, direct text designed to guide visitors down a sales funnel.

Jasper is incredibly capable of producing high-level product roundups and review structures, but its character ceilings on lower tiers and premium pricing can restrict solo affiliate deployment. Furthermore, Rytr’s lightning-fast user experience allows you to jump from writing email sequences to updating product list hooks in seconds. For performance marketers who prioritize uninhibited testing speed and low cost-per-article generation over deep brand-voice training sheets, Rytr provides the higher operational ROI.


Agency Comparison

When running a professional digital marketing or SEO agency managing multiple distinct client accounts, Jasper wins the category completely.

The biggest operational bottleneck inside an agency workspace is preserving brand consistency. Every client has unique stylistic criteria, technical boundaries, background documentation, and messaging preferences. Rytr’s minimalist interface is designed for single-user footprints and lacks the multi-layered partitioning systems required to segregate diverse accounts.

Jasper’s enterprise infrastructure is custom-built for agency governance. Its Pro and Business setups allow project managers to isolate client assets into dedicated workspace directories. Agencies can train specific AI brand voices and attach distinctive background knowledge sheets for every account. This allows copywriters to transition instantly from writing a technical B2B SaaS whitepaper to drafting a casual lifestyle brand email list, knowing the AI engine will always match the exact parameters of the active client profile.
